SOLAR CELL AND PREPARATION METHOD THEREFOR
In one aspect, a preparation method for a solar cell includes: forming a target amorphous silicon layer on a side of a silicon wafer using a preset process, and then performing an annealing treatment on the target amorphous silicon layer to convert the target amorphous silicon layer into a target polycrystalline silicon layer, wherein the preset process includes at least one cycle period, the at least one cycle period comprises: depositing a target amorphous silicon preformed layer with a preset thickness and performing a hydrogen gas plasma treatment on the target amorphous silicon preformed layer, wherein the preset thickness of the target amorphous silicon preformed layer is less than or equal to a thickness of the target amorphous silicon layer. This method can effectively improve a crystallization rate of converting amorphous silicon into polycrystalline silicon, improving field passivation performance and contact performance of the solar cell.
METHOD FOR PREPARING HETEROJUNCTION SOLAR CELL, HETEROJUNCTION SOLAR CELL AND APPLICATION THEREOF
A preparation method of a heterojunction solar cell includes following steps: depositing a first passivation layer on a first surface of a silicon substrate by using a gas source, a base material of the first passivation layer being hydrogenated amorphous silicon; during depositing hydrogenated amorphous silicon of the first passivation layer, allowing the gas source to gradually incorporate carbon dioxide, and controlling a proportion of carbon dioxide in the gas source to gradually increase with increase of a thickness of the first passivation layer which has been deposited.
SOLAR CELL AND METHOD OF MANUFACTURING THE SAME
The present invention provides a method of manufacturing a solar cell, the method including: a process of forming a first semiconductor layer on an upper surface of a semiconductor wafer and forming a second semiconductor layer, having a polarity different from a polarity of the first semiconductor layer, on a lower surface of the semiconductor wafer; a process of forming a first transparent conductive layer on an upper surface of the first semiconductor layer to externally expose a portion of the first semiconductor layer and forming a second transparent conductive layer on a lower surface of the second semiconductor layer to externally expose a portion of the second semiconductor layer; and a plasma treatment process on at least one of the first transparent conductive layer and the second transparent conductive layer, wherein the plasma treatment process includes a process of removing the externally exposed portion of the first semiconductor layer and the externally exposed portion of the second semiconductor layer.
SOLAR CELL AND METHOD FOR MANUFACTURING THE SAME
A solar cell includes: a semiconductor substrate including an uneven portion, the uneven portion being located on at least one of a front surface or a rear surface of the semiconductor substrate; a passivation layer disposed on the uneven portion; and an oxide layer disposed between the passivation layer and the uneven portion of the semiconductor substrate, the oxide layer including amorphous oxide.

Method for manufacturing light absorption layer of thin film solar cell and thin film solar cell using the same
A method for manufacturing a light absorption layer of a thin film solar cell in in a method for manufacturing a solar cell transparent electrode may be provided that includes: manufacturing a Ib group element-VIa group element binary system nano particle (s100); manufacturing a binary system nano particle slurry of the Ib group element-VIa group element by adding a solvent, binder and a solution precursor including Va group element to the Ib group element-VIa group element binary system nano particle (s200); distributing and mixing the binary system nano particle slurry of the Ib group element-VIa group element (s300); coating the binary system nano particle slurry of the Ib group element-VIa group element on the rear electrode layer 200 (s400); and performing a heat treatment process on the coated nano particle slurry by supplying the VIa group element (s500).
METHOD OF PROCESSING INCONSISTENCIES IN SOLAR CELL DEVICES AND DEVICES FORMED THEREBY
The present disclosure is directed to a method of processing a solar cell device. The method comprises detecting at least one inconsistency at a surface of a semiconductor substrate having a solar cell active region formed therein. A deposition pattern is determined based on the location of the at least one inconsistency. A material is selectively deposited on the substrate according to the deposition pattern.

Zinc Oxide-Crystalline Silicon Laminated Solar Cell And Preparation Method Thereof
The present application discloses a zinc oxide-crystalline silicon laminated solar cell and a preparation method thereof, relates to the technical field of solar cells, and aims to solve the technical problem of low photoelectric conversion rate of existing solar cells. The zinc oxide-crystalline silicon laminated solar cell includes: a P-type silicon substrate layer; a front surface of the P-type silicon substrate layer being sequentially formed with, from bottom to top, a diffusion layer, an N-type zinc oxide layer, a first passivation layer, and a first antireflection layer; wherein the N-type zinc oxide layer is made of tetrapod-like N-type zinc oxide whisker powder as a raw material; and a back surface of the P-type silicon substrate layer being sequentially formed with, from top to bottom, a second passivation layer and a second antireflection layer; and an electrode, the electrode including a front electrode and a back electrode.
